Oakland Raiders owner, Al Davis, known for his rebellious nature and famous catch phrase “Just win, baby!,” died Saturday, Oct 8, at the age of 82. Al Davis July 4, 1929 – October 8, 2011.
New England Patriots Quarterback, Tom Brady, makes history when he passed from the protection of the pocket and connected with a 99 yard touchdown pass to Wes Welker on Monday night to defeat the Miami Dolphins in a 34-28 victory.

CANTON, OH – Deion Sanders delivered an emotional speech after his induction into the Pro Football Hall of Fame on Saturday night, August 6 in Canton, Ohio.

Pittsburgh Steelers wide receive Hines Ward hopes to make a difference among today’s inner city youth by establishing the “Helping Hands Foundation” in order to improve literacy. Hines Ward Helping Hands Foundation and charity work for biracial Korean children.
The recent “Dancing with the Stars” winner is championing a cause very near to his heart. He has established the Hines Ward “Helping Hands Foundation” with the specific intention of improving literacy amongst inner-city youth and has also expanded to South Korea where it helps biracial children confront discrimination. Round 1 of the 2011 NFL Draft picks are in. Auburn quarterback Cam Newton was selected as the first pick overall by the Carolina Panthers in the NFL football draft at Radio City Music Hall on Thursday, April 28, 2011, in New York. Cam Newton, Heisman Trophy Winner, is selected by Carolina Panthers in 2011 NFL Draft.
Texas A&M linebacker Von Miller went No. 2 overall to the Denver Broncos.
